The attitude towards disclosure of bad news to cancer patients in Saudi Arabia

摘要

Disclosing the diagnosis or prognosis to cancer patients in Saudi Arabia can be a serious challenge to the physician in his daily clinic practice. The public attitude towards full disclosure is still conservative, and in order to appropriately deal with such an attitude, physicians need to deeply understand its sociocultural background. This article attempts to look into what governs the public attitude towards disclosure in Saudi Arabia as an example of what may affect attitudes in developing countries. It also brings some data from local surveys among physicians and patients as well as from public surveys to describe the changing trend in attitude over the years with a comparative analysis of the Western literature.
机译:向沙特阿拉伯的癌症患者透露诊断或预后可能对医师的日常临床实践构成严峻挑战。公众对于全面披露的态度仍然是保守的,为了适当地应对这种态度,医生需要深刻理解其社会文化背景。本文试图探讨是什么决定了沙特阿拉伯公众对信息披露态度的规范,以作为可能影响发展中国家态度的一个例子。它还从医生和患者的当地调查以及公共调查中获得一些数据,以通过对西方文献的比较分析来描述多年来态度的变化趋势。
